Coty Targeting White Space In Women’s Prestige Fragrances, Ultra-Premium Scents After Strong FY2023
Coty Inc. sees opportunities to grow its business in the $24bn prestige female fragrance market and strengthen its play in the ‘ultra-premium’ segment. The firm’s prestige fragrance sales rose 20% like-for-like in the fiscal 2023 fourth quarter ended 30 June, fueling overall net sales growth of 10% for the period.

Givaudan Pursues Biotech-Based Fragrance, Unveils ‘Wellbeing Solutions’ For Boomers
Givaudan will be working with LanzaTech NZ to develop fragrance ingredients the biotech way, and is launching a Silver Radiance program to meet the wellness needs of adults over the age of 55. Meanwhile, the firm’s fine fragrance sales in the first nine months of 2022 jumped 14.8%.
